Full Description
This book showcases the latest research trends, methodologies, and experimental findings across a wide spectrum of cutting-edge topics, as a prominent academic conference in the field of electrical engineering in China. These include electrical technology, power systems, electromagnetic emission techniques, and electrical equipment, reflecting the field's close alignment with ongoing advancements in multiple technological domains.
The objective of the proceedings is to provide a comprehensive interdisciplinary platform for researchers, engineers, academics, and industry professionals to present innovative research and development outcomes in electrical engineering. This forum encourages the exchange of ideas that integrate knowledge from diverse disciplines, fostering deeper insights into complex engineering challenges.
This book serves as a valuable reference for researchers and graduate students, offering a rich resource for exploring state-of-the-art theories and practical solutions in electrical engineering.
